pkgsrc-Changes-HG arch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

[pkgsrc/trunk]: pkgsrc/sysutils ufetch: Import ufetch-0.2 as sysutils/ufetch



details:   https://anonhg.NetBSD.org/pkgsrc/rev/ae66381d2d0b
branches:  trunk
changeset: 420032:ae66381d2d0b
user:      ng0 <ng0%pkgsrc.org@localhost>
date:      Tue Dec 31 11:16:49 2019 +0000

description:
ufetch: Import ufetch-0.2 as sysutils/ufetch

packaged by pin <voidpin%protonmail.com@localhost> in pkgsrc-wip

Tiny system info for Unix-like operating systems.

diffstat:

 sysutils/Makefile           |   3 +-
 sysutils/ufetch/DESCR       |   1 +
 sysutils/ufetch/Makefile    |  49 +++++++++++++++++++++++++++++++++++++++++++++
 sysutils/ufetch/PLIST       |   2 +
 sysutils/ufetch/PLIST.Linux |  32 +++++++++++++++++++++++++++++
 sysutils/ufetch/distinfo    |   6 +++++
 6 files changed, 92 insertions(+), 1 deletions(-)

diffs (127 lines):

di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/Makefile
--- a/sysutils/Makefile Tue Dec 31 10:45:19 2019 +0000
+++ b/sysutils/Makefile Tue Dec 31 11:16:49 2019 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: Makefile,v 1.849 2019/12/29 01:33:09 fox Exp $
+# $NetBSD: Makefile,v 1.850 2019/12/31 11:16:49 ng0 Exp $
 #
 
 COMMENT=       System utilities
@@ -673,6 +673,7 @@
 SUBDIR+=       u-boot-sopine-baseboard
 SUBDIR+=       u-boot-tinker
 SUBDIR+=       u-boot-zynq-zybo-z7
+SUBDIR+=       ufetch
 SUBDIR+=       upower
 SUBDIR+=       ups-nut
 SUBDIR+=       ups-nut-cgi
di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/ufetch/DESCR
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/sysutils/ufetch/DESCR     Tue Dec 31 11:16:49 2019 +0000
@@ -0,0 +1,1 @@
+Tiny system info for Unix-like operating systems.
di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/ufetch/Makefile
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/sysutils/ufetch/Makefile  Tue Dec 31 11:16:49 2019 +0000
@@ -0,0 +1,49 @@
+# $NetBSD: Makefile,v 1.3 2019/12/31 11:16:49 ng0 Exp $
+
+DISTNAME=      ufetch-v0.2
+PKGNAME=       ${DISTNAME:S/-v/-/}
+CATEGORIES=    sysutils
+MASTER_SITES=  https://gitlab.com/jschx/ufetch/-/archive/v${PKGVERSION_NOREV}/
+
+MAINTAINER=    voidpin%protonmail.com@localhost
+HOMEPAGE=      https://gitlab.com/jschx/ufetch/
+COMMENT=       Tiny system info for Unix-like Operating Systems
+LICENSE=       isc
+
+USE_LANGUAGES= # none
+NO_BUILD=      yes
+
+INSTALLATION_DIRS+=    bin
+
+.include "../../mk/bsd.prefs.mk"
+
+.if ${OPSYS} == "NetBSD"
+FLAVOR=        netbsd
+.elif ${OPSYS} == "OpenBSD"
+FLAVOR=        openbsd
+.elif ${OPSYS} == "FreeBSD"
+FLAVOR=        freebsd
+.elif ${OPSYS} == "Darwin"
+FLAVOR=        macos
+.elif ${OPSYS} == "Linux"
+FLAVOR=        linux
+.else
+BROKEN=        "Unsupported OS"
+.endif
+
+do-install:
+       ${RUN} cd ${WRKSRC} && \
+               ${INSTALL_SCRIPT} \
+                       ufetch-${FLAVOR} ${DESTDIR}${PREFIX}/bin/ufetch
+.if ${OPSYS} == "Linux"
+.  for f in alpine antergos arch archbang arco artix aux centos crux debian \
+          elementary fedora gentoo gnewsense guixsd hyperbola linuxlite mageia \
+          manjaro mint mx nixos parabola popos pureos raspbian slackware suse \
+          ubuntu void
+       ${RUN} cd ${WRKSRC} && \
+               ${INSTALL_SCRIPT} \
+                       ufetch-${f} ${DESTDIR}${PREFIX}/bin/ufetch-${f}
+.  endfor
+.endif
+
+.include "../../mk/bsd.pkg.mk"
di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/ufetch/PLIST
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/sysutils/ufetch/PLIST     Tue Dec 31 11:16:49 2019 +0000
@@ -0,0 +1,2 @@
+@comment $NetBSD: PLIST,v 1.3 2019/12/31 11:16:49 ng0 Exp $
+bin/ufetch
di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/ufetch/PLIST.Linux
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/sysutils/ufetch/PLIST.Linux       Tue Dec 31 11:16:49 2019 +0000
@@ -0,0 +1,32 @@
+@comment $NetBSD: PLIST.Linux,v 1.3 2019/12/31 11:16:49 ng0 Exp $
+bin/ufetch-alpine
+bin/ufetch-antergos
+bin/ufetch-arch
+bin/ufetch-archbang
+bin/ufetch-arco
+bin/ufetch-artix
+bin/ufetch-aux
+bin/ufetch-centos
+bin/ufetch-crux
+bin/ufetch-debian
+bin/ufetch-elementary
+bin/ufetch-fedora
+bin/ufetch-gentoo
+bin/ufetch-gnewsense
+bin/ufetch-guixsd
+bin/ufetch-hyperbola
+bin/ufetch-linuxlite
+bin/ufetch-mageia
+bin/ufetch-manjaro
+bin/ufetch-mint
+bin/ufetch-mx
+bin/ufetch-nixos
+bin/ufetch-parabola
+bin/ufetch-popos
+bin/ufetch-pureos
+bin/ufetch-raspbian
+bin/ufetch-slackware
+bin/ufetch-suse
+bin/ufetch-ubuntu
+bin/ufetch-void
+bin/ufetch-voyager
diff -r 3c42d4e1f73b -r ae66381d2d0b sysutils/ufetch/distinfo
--- /dev/null   Thu Jan 01 00:00:00 1970 +0000
+++ b/sysutils/ufetch/distinfo  Tue Dec 31 11:16:49 2019 +0000
@@ -0,0 +1,6 @@
+$NetBSD: distinfo,v 1.3 2019/12/31 11:16:49 ng0 Exp $
+
+SHA1 (ufetch-v0.2.tar.gz) = 747546eface0fdce659e3f04a9ba524280bfd37f
+RMD160 (ufetch-v0.2.tar.gz) = 89360a31e7bf56bf492701b6949e6cb90b63cdf7
+SHA512 (ufetch-v0.2.tar.gz) = 814052ac45bdd226a36453b392b0d723d3483ae43ce7000a315c0d926f05bbad31ed63f384b64b5dacf2cecc6f60c1f436417c5599d27ec44313544d2ae568b9
+Size (ufetch-v0.2.tar.gz) = 44302 bytes



Home | Main Index | Thread Index | Old Index